gpt4 book ai didi

Docker-MySQL5.6 未知变量 lower_case_table_names=1

转载 作者:行者123 更新时间:2023-12-02 18:03:11 29 4
gpt4 key购买 nike

我想在 MySQL 5.6 docker 容器中将变量 lower_case_table_names 设置为 1。

我把变量放在容器中/etc/mysql下的my.cnf文件[mysqld]中。

停止容器后它没有开始给出这个错误:

unknown variable lower_case_table_names=1

那么我要问的是还有其他方法可以将此变量设置为 1 吗?

最佳答案

我希望你已经找到了答案,但这样的事情是可行的:
docker run -p 3306:3306 mysql:5.6 -e MYSQL_ALLOW_EMPTY_PASSWORD=1 mysqld --lower_case_table_names=1

对于 docker-compose,这是可行的:

services:
db:
image: mysql:5.7
restart: always
command: --lower_case_table_names=1
environment:
MYSQL_DATABASE: 'test'

关于Docker-MySQL5.6 未知变量 lower_case_table_names=1,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/50483006/

29 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com